Short wash, no dryer.

 

Or, if I'm too lazy to do the regular wash and do the up and down all of the stairs thing, I wash by hand in a plastic bowl/bin, and drip dry, over the tub on a rod.

 

Also, as I've mentioned somewhere before, I have set aside one small-ish salad spinner that I only use to dry small, delicate items.  Speeds up drying time.  

Then fully dry on hangers on a wooden drying rack in a sunny room, in front of the window.
